Stella981 Stella981
3年前
JS微任务 宏任务,Promise、setTimeout、setImmediate运行顺序实测
结论如下1.虽然理论上应当先运行Promise,再运行setTimeout。但是由于历史版本或使用polyfill,使得Promise未必优先运行。2.setImmediate未必比setTimeout早运行3.在最新浏览器中Promise会早于事件冒泡运行,在设计框架时应考虑这一情况以下是实测情况\
Stella981 Stella981
3年前
Angular Elements 组件在非angular 页面中使用的DEMO
一、AngularElements介绍   AngularElements是伴随Angular6.0一起推出的新技术。它借助Chrome浏览器的ShadowDom API,实现一种自定义组件。这种组件可以用Angular普通组件的开发技术进行编写,学习成本低,当它构建好后生成一个打包的js文件
绣鸾 绣鸾
1年前
PullTube for Mac(在线视频下载工具) 1.8.5.20中文版
是一款Mac电脑上的视频下载工具,可以帮助用户从多个视频网站下载视频,并支持多种视频格式和分辨率选择。PullTube支持多种视频网站,如YouTube、Vimeo、Facebook、DAIlymotion等,用户可以通过输入视频链接或使用内置浏览器来获取